.focus{ position:relative; width:1110px; height:446px; margin: 0 auto;z-index: 2}
.focus img{ width: 797px; height: 446px;float: left}
.focus .fPic{ position:absolute; left:0px; top:0px;}
.focus .D1fBt{ overflow:hidden; zoom:1;  height:16px; z-index:10;  }
.focus .shadow{ width:241px;z-index:10; height:404px; background:#008f80; display:block; text-align:left;float: right;padding: 42px 40px 0 32px;position: relative}
.focus .shadow h2{color: #fff;line-height: 24px;font-size: 24px;margin-bottom: 20px}
.focus .shadow .rxPhone{display: block;background: url("/static/index/images/rxphone.png") no-repeat left center;height: 17px;line-height: 17px;font-size: 14px;color: #fff;padding-left: 22px;margin-bottom: 11px;}
.focus .shadow .rxaddress{display: block;background: url("/static/index/images/rxadress.png") no-repeat left center;height: 17px;line-height: 17px;font-size: 14px;color: #fff;padding-left: 22px;margin-bottom: 30px;}
.focus .shadow p{color: #fff;line-height: 24px;font-size: 14px;margin-bottom: 10px;word-wrap: break-word}
.focus .fcon{ position:relative; width:100%; float:left;  display:none; background:#000  }
.focus .shadow .rxckgd{display: block;width: 105px;height: 25px;color: #fff;border: 1px solid #fff;text-align: center;line-height: 25px;position: absolute;bottom: 24px;left: 32px;}
.focus .fcon img{ display:block; }
/*.focus .fbg{ position:absolute; bottom:68px; left:940px; height:10px; text-align:center; z-index:9999 }*/
.focus .fbg div{margin-top:11px;overflow:hidden;zoom:1;height:14px}
/*.focus .D1fBt a{position:relative; display:inline; width:12px; height:12px; margin:0 5px;color:#B0B0B0;font:12px/15px "\5B8B\4F53"; text-decoration:none; text-align:center; outline:0; float:left; background:url(/static/index/Images/banner_li2.jpg) no-repeat; }*/
/*.focus .D1fBt .current,.focus .D1fBt a:hover{background:url(/static/index/Images/banner_li1.jpg) no-repeat}*/
.focus .D1fBt img{display:none}
.focus .D1fBt i{display:none; font-style:normal; }
.focus .prev,.focus .next{position:absolute;width:35px;height:35px;background: url(/static/index/images/rxxmjt.png) no-repeat;display: block;margin-top: -17px}
.focus .prev{top: 50%; left: 23px;background-position:0 0px; cursor:pointer; }
.focus .next{top: 50%;right: 334px;  background-position:-39px 0px ;  cursor:pointer;}
.focus .prev:hover{  background-position:0 -44px; }
.focus .next:hover{  background-position:-39px -44px;}



@media only screen and (max-width: 1024px) and (min-width: 320px) {
    .nav2{height: 35px}
    .nav2 a{width: 33%}
    .focus{width: 100%!important;height: auto}
    .focus img{width: 100%;height: auto}
    .focus .fcon{background: none}
    .focus .shadow{width: 96%;padding: 20px 2% 50px;height: auto}
    .focus .fPic{position: static}
    .focus .shadow .rxckgd{bottom: 20px;left: 2%}
	    .focus .prev, .focus .next{z-index: 99999;margin-top: 0;top: 20%}
    .focus .prev{left: 10px;}
    .focus .next{right: 10px;}

}














<!--ºÄÊ±1752790898.179Ãë-->